Fifth Harmony's Ally Brooke: 'Taylor Swift's new material is out of this world'

Songstress Ally Brooke Hernandez, of Fifth Harmony fame, has praised Taylor Swift's new material and described it as 'out of this world'. 

The 'Bo$$' beauty took to her official Twitter page earlier today (October 24) and told her followers that she loves Swift's new song 'Out Of The Woods' and is really excited for the upcoming release of her new record, '1989':

"#OutOfTheWoods more like #Outofthisworld omg fantastic as always @taylorswift13 , CANT WAIT FOR YOUR ALBUM."

Swift's highly anticipated new album is due to be released later this month on October 27 and she admitted that it's a pop record, but her label wanted her to include two songs that were firmly within the country genre to honour her career's origins

The girl group, meanwhile, recently confirmed that their brand new single will be called 'Sledgehammer' and shared a post about the exciting news via their social media page: "GUYS!!! Our next single is #Sledgehammer! Ahh, we're freaking out....can't wait for you to hear it!! #5HBigAnnouncement."
